Job Description: The Manager, Protective Services is a key leader in Saskatchewan health care, partnering with system leaders to achieve our provinces healthcare goals. Reporting to the Director of Protective Services and Health Emergency Management the Manager is responsible for creating operational lines of sight that connect to the goals and objectives of the SHA. The Manager supports strategy through the development and execution of operational and business plans, including cascading, monitoring, reporting, and course correction of same. The Manager demonstrates strong leadership to enable an innovative and positive working climate and a client-centric culture. The Manager must work cross functionally within the portfolio and across the organization to support operations. The Manager will develop partnerships and work closely with system and community partners.
Required Qualifications

Education in emergency preparedness, Incident Command structure, Protective Services, security systems and procedures, threat assessment, risk management programs and the application of law
Licensed and in good standing with professional association and/or regulatory body, if applicable
Undergraduate degree or diploma in health care related discipline preferred, or an equivalent combination of education and experience
Valid Class 5 driver's license
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

Demonstrates and is recognized for strategic and operational leadership that includes articulation of mission, vision and strategy and charts a path forward
Demonstrates commitment to a diverse, culturally competent and culturally safe health system and representative workforce
